Why Traditional Approaches Fall Short
Traditional approaches to account segmentation can be inefficient. They often impede revenue acceleration. Users of generic CRM systems, for example, frequently encounter rigid segmentation rules that necessitate manual updates and lack the agility to incorporate real-time signals. These systems are often designed as databases. They require RevOps to export, manipulate, and re-import data - a process that can lead to errors and delays. Basic data enrichment tools often provide static information that quickly becomes outdated, leading teams to make critical decisions based on old firmographics or technographics. This can be a significant drawback in dynamic markets.
Teams relying on these tools may find them insufficient. They often report that these systems struggle to connect disparate data points from across their revenue technology stack into a unified view. Such systems may not be able to ingest web behavior, product usage, intent signals, and CRM data to automatically identify shifting account priorities or new buying groups. Developers using basic scripting or dashboard solutions note the maintenance overhead and the difficulty in scaling complex segmentation logic. These tools can demand constant manual oversight and coding, creating a bottleneck that limits RevOps' ability to focus on strategic initiatives. They are often reactive rather than proactive, which may not meet the requirements of modern RevOps.

Practical Examples
In a representative scenario, consider a sales team launching a new product. They might find existing account lists outdated and lacking specific technographic data needed to identify ideal prospects. Without advanced tools, a RevOps professional might spend weeks manually gathering data from various sources to identify accounts using competitor products or specific technologies. This manual process is slow and can be prone to errors. By the time a list is ready, market conditions may have shifted, potentially leading to inefficient sales cycles.
Clay offers a different approach. With Clay, RevOps can deploy AI agents to automatically scan many accounts, identify those leveraging specific technologies, and filter them based on recent intent signals for the new product category, all in real-time. This can result in a highly targeted account list delivered to sales quickly, potentially improving win rates.
Another challenge is reacting swiftly to customer behavior changes. For instance, an existing customer account might increase product usage in a particular module, signaling potential for an upsell to a more advanced tier. Without Clay, this signal might remain unnoticed within product analytics until a later review, by which time the opportunity could be diminished or lost. Clay’s AI agents continuously monitor these behavioral changes, automatically re-segmenting accounts based on real-time usage spikes or new feature adoption. This instant re-segmentation can trigger an alert to the account management team, providing them with an enriched account profile and a timely, personalized upsell opportunity. This proactive approach supports capturing revenue opportunities that might otherwise be missed due to data lag.
